Learning a language requires a certain attitude of openness towards the new language and the way it sounds. Some people will claim they are trying to learn French but then hold on to the way their native language works. The mistake many people make when learning another language is that they cling to the rules of their old language and try to make the new one obey those rules. You have to realize that every language is unique. Not only does each language have its unique vocabulary, but also its own structure and grammar. People who are not familiar with other languages often expect every language to work the same way. When you want to learn French, you will do much better if you accept that it's going to be different in some ways from your native language.

Try to get some help from anyone who is fluent in French and willing to do it. Such a friend will greatly accelerate your learning the right usage of the language as well as the right pronunciation. This friend will also be helpful because he or she will be someone around whom you feel comfortable making mistakes and trying out new things. It'll be a lot more fun with this friend helping you along the way. One nice thing is this friend will come to know you and the best way for you to learn. You really can learn much faster this way because this person will recognize the best way for you to learn and will be better able to help you.

You can eliminate discomfort by being willing to be uncomfortable. If you take classes it will help you to remember that everyone is starting at the exact same point. No one will laugh if you use the wrong tense or make some other common mistake. Hey, all the others are beginners! One of the biggest hindrances to the learning process is feeling self conscious and not letting yourself make mistakes because you're afraid of feeling silly. Just keep in mind that everyone else is new to French, too. So just allow yourself to make mistakes, or say things the wrong way. You'll have an easier time of learning and so will everybody else!

Flashcards can be particularly effective. Flashcards frequently have a bad name because they're much used for teaching kids, however with regards to learning a new language this technique trumps pretty much everything else. In these high-tech times why on earth would we use something as elementary as flashcards? The reason why people in Falconwood still make use of flashcards is because they work! Flash cards are an awesome way to practice your skills and quiz yourself. They're a portable learning tool; just slip them in your bag or pocket and go. Another positive feature of flashcards is that you're able to practice with a friend, your children, or a significant other without them needing to have any knowledge of your new language. In the end, there are few methods that are able to match the convenience and effectiveness of flashcards.

Find French language books or newspapers and practice reading them. If you want to get more comfortable with how to create sentences, as well as improve your vocabulary, reading in French is great practice. If you want to become accustomed to the specific ways words are used and the rules of grammar work, the best method is to practice reading in that language. If you read as much as you can in French, or any new language you want to learn, you will find your overall ability to understand and be understood in the new language will greatly improve.

A French language CD will have a large impact on your efforts. CDs are portable so you can dedicate a large portion of time to soaking in the language. Even if you do not have a portable CD player (remember those?) you probably still have a way to burn a CD onto your computer and convert the file to play on your mp3 player. The important thing is increasing the time spent learning and you do this by taking your course with you. This will allow you to learn anywhere, from sitting in the doctor's office to trying to survive a boring lecture or in a traffic jam.

Another fun method to complement your portable learning is to tune in to French TV whenever you can. In the beginning you can let yourself turn the movies subtitles on, but as you learn more of the language turn the subtitles off. In no time you will be up on phrases that you already knew and learn many new ones. Watching a talk show or movie will introduce you to popular phrases, tones of voice, and cultural aspects that you can't get from a language CD. Classroom language learning works but what they teach is not what people actually use on the streets and in social settings. If you ever want to move beyond the boring classroom language lessons then you must start using the television shows and movies that are available to you.

If you are able to immerse yourself in the language then you can really learn your new language in depth. Some people react rather well when they are put under pressure. The best way to use this method is to temporarily relocate or take a vacation to a place where the main language is the one you're trying to learn. This strategy is those that are very serious about learning a new language, this method literally forces you to become a fluent speaker very quickly. Immersion is not for everyone, but some find that it is one of the only ways for them to learn how to communicate in a language that is not their own.

French Audio Lessons

There are many good books, flashcard sets and websites that do a brilliant job teaching written French. However, a vital way to succeed is to add audio lessons into your study resources. Introducing audio is crucial for various reasons.

When somebody concentrates all of their study on the written word, it is certainly possible to learn a great deal of material, but it is also possible that they might be learning the wrong things. What we mean by this is that a student could have a perception of how a particular word sounds that, as they've never actually heard it, could be entirely wrong. They continue to study and learn, cementing the incorrect pronunciation in their head. At some time they will use it, be corrected, and then be faced with relearning the word or words.

The brain learns better when it's tested in a number of different ways. By combining writing and reading French with hearing it as well, the brain will store the information much better than simply reading it. Adding audio lessons also helps keep the student's interest, because studying doesn't get boring when it involves different inputs.

Audio lessons with native French speakers can teach so much that cannot be learned from a book. The proper pronunciation as well as conversational tone and inflection can only be learned by listening. By repeatedly listening to French, one can develop their own, natural sounding conversational tone instead of a strained, mechanical, "by the book" style that is very unnatural.

Some computer programs offer the option of being able to record yourself speaking French, too. Being able to hear it, speak it, then replay and compare the two is very helpful. Having this instant feedback and being able to make adjustments is a great learning tool.

Another very positive aspect of audio French lessons is convenience. The ability to listen to French in the car, working out, or anywhere else is a huge plus. The more often that you hear it, the better you will learn and retain it.

Read it, write it, and listen to it. This multimedia approach will enhance your French language learning much more rapidly and make it a lot more enjoyable, too.

What Are The Benefits of One-to-One French Lessons?

Multiple benefits can be obtained through one-to-one French lessons when compared to self-study or group lessons. Below are some advantages of opting for individual, personalised French tutoring:

  1. Focus on Specific Challenges: In case you face specific hurdles in French, such as verb conjugations, intricate grammar rules, or pronunciation of specific sounds, a private tutor can dedicate extra time to tackle those issues. They can offer specialized drills, exercises, and explanations to assist you in overcoming those specific challenges.
  2. Personalised Attention: Through one-to-one lessons, your language teacher dedicates their undivided attention to you, enabling them to understand and address your specific requirements, weaknesses, and learning style. Consequently, the lessons are customised to ensure efficient learning and expedited progress.
  3. Confidence Building: Confidence in speaking French is nurtured through the encouraging and supportive atmosphere of one-to-one lessons. Since there are no other students present, you may feel more at ease to ask questions, practice speaking, and make mistakes without fear of judgment. The tutor plays a crucial role in helping you overcome language barriers by providing guidance and assistance.
  4. Flexibility and Pace: In one-to-one lessons, you are empowered to learn at the pace that suits you best. The teacher can adapt the speed of instruction according to your understanding, ensuring a comprehensive grasp of the material before proceeding further. Additionally, the schedule of lessons can be tailored to suit your availability and convenience.
  5. Motivation and Accountability: A private tutor can function as a mentor, ensuring your motivation and accountability towards your learning progress. They can offer guidance, establish achievable targets, and monitor your improvement. The personalized attention and support from a tutor can assist you in maintaining focus and dedication to your French learning journey.
  6. Enhanced Speaking Skills: Cultivating regular conversation practice with a native or proficient French speaker is indispensable for refining your speaking skills. In one-to-one lessons, you have ample occasions to actively participate in dialogues, refine pronunciation, and enhance fluency. This personalized speaking practice greatly amplifies your confidence and communication abilities.
  7. Immediate Feedback: With focused individualized attention, you receive timely feedback on your progress, pronunciation, grammar, and vocabulary usage. This enables you to promptly identify and correct mistakes, effectively improving your language skills. The tutor can offer immediate explanations and clarifications, leading to a deeper understanding of the language.
  8. Customised Curriculum: A private tutor is capable of devising a curriculum that caters to your learning goals and interests. This grants you the flexibility to shape the lesson content based on your preferences, be it conversational French, grammar, pronunciation, or particular topics you wish to explore.

Overall, one-to-one French lessons offer a highly personalised and effective learning experience, ensuring you receive individualised attention, progress at your own pace, and develop strong language skills.

French Exam Preparation

French exam preparation is essential for students who want to do well in their assessments and show the extent of their language skills. No matter what type of assessment it is, effective preparation is essential to achieving the desired outcomes.

There are a range of techniques that can be applied to ensure success in French examinations. Vital is dedicating ample time to studying and reviewing essential grammar rules, vocabulary and verb conjugations, is first an foremost. This foundation forms the basis of language comprehension and accurate communication. Listening, writing , speaking and reading French are equally important to practice regularly. Being interdependent, these language skills collectively contribute to a well-rounded proficiency.

Another crucial aspect of exam preparation is to employ a number of different resources. Practice tests, grammar guides and interactive exercises are just a few of the many resources available on online platforms. French students can use textbooks to reinforce learning by completing lessons and exercises. Finally, reviewing past exam papers can help students to reduce the chance of surprises on the exam day by giving them a better understanding of the exam format and the types of questions that are likely to be asked.

Individualised study schedules that take into account students' strengths and weaknesses are essential. Different language components such as comprehension, grammar, vocabulary and writing should be assigned specific time slots in order to manage the preparation process successfully. A comprehensive understanding of the subject matter is essential, and last-minute cramming must be prevented.

Enhancing comprehension and retention is achievable through the use of active learning methods. The assistance of flashcards, mnemonic tools and language applications can aid in the memorisation of verb conjugations and vocabulary. By participating in language exchange programs or conversation groups, individuals can practice their listening and speaking skills with native French speakers, lending authenticity to their language usage.

By seeking assistance from language experts, one can gain valuable guidance and feedback to enhance their language skills. They can suggest effective learning techniques, offer insights into common errors, and provide personalised strategies to address shortcomings.

Also, it is important to remain as organised as one can be. By arranging study materials, notes, and other resources neatly, one can save time and reduce stress during revision. Additionally, ensuring that time is utilised effectively allows for all elements of the language to be adequately explored and provides enough opportunity for practice.

Equally, entering French exams with a positive frame of mind is essential. A pivotal role in achieving good performance is played by maintaining self-confidence, managing exam anxiety and staying calm. Anxiety can be reduced by visualising success and focusing on the progress made during preparation.

To sum up, the preparation for a French exam is a complex process necessitating organisation, dedication, and the employment of proven strategies. Leveraging various different resources to delve into grammar, vocabulary, listening, speaking, reading, and writing guarantees a comprehensive approach to language proficiency. Active engagement, expert guidance and a positive mindset are fundamental in reaching desirable outcomes. A comprehensive approach, coupled with consistent practice and diligent effort, enables students to tackle their French exams with assurance and realise their academic aspirations.
